Transaction 77d64450e98b52b9055953487a88216b3ac962cf60eb00e6344c3b129bb97081

1 Input
2 Outputs
  • 77d64450e98b52b9055953487a88216b3ac962cf60eb00e6344c3b129bb97081:0
  • value  3762956
    address  18k4CwbWJxtagfMbkXTvkvMDW8ob17YR3F
  • 77d64450e98b52b9055953487a88216b3ac962cf60eb00e6344c3b129bb97081:1
  • value  10475386
    address  1NNUARswdTyxsZGtLE9c8aUxzroPrfHPYQ